Decent.... but not special:
This is another techno/remix CD just like One Thousand and One Nights from Said Mrad however this one is not nearly as good. This is more like "lounge techno" and less like dance techno. All the songs are good, but uninspiring. Good to listen to while working or such, but it is not going to make you stand up and dance. Side note: Friend who is not into belly dance music liked this album better than One Thousand and One nights because it was "less ethnic and more like new age techno".

Bellydance house music, finally!:
I love this cd and may very well become one of my absolute favorites. I am a true househead and a pro bellydancer and I have been searching for a long time for a good fusion of the two. Well, the search is over, this is it. Tons of fun, Bellylicious can cause me to dance myself into oblivion. This is a good fusion because it is not overly-techno (high-pitched electronic with hyper-speed rhythm) and most of the tracks do not compromise the actual Arabic rhythms. The two worlds blend well so as to not sound like two neighbors blaring totally different radio stations at the same time. I don't like all of the tracks but for me, if I like a third of them on a bellydance cd it's a thumbs up, I'm just that picky about my music. I especially love "Turkish Delight".
